Instant Cashback: fast returns by VIP tier
Pacific Spins' Instant Cashback rewards are tiered and generous for higher-status players. Depending on your VIP level you can receive up to 30% back on eligible clean deposit losses:
- Wave Rider 15%
- Treasure Hunter 20%
- Pirate Captain 20%
- Cruise Director 25%
- Admiral of the Fleet 30%
Key rules you should know: Instant Cashback carries a 15x wagering requirement and is capped at 5x the cashback amount. There's also a minimum cashout threshold of $50 — meaning smaller cashback amounts may need to accumulate or pair with other funds before you can withdraw. Eligible games for these credits include non-progressive slots, video poker, and certain blackjack games. Restricted titles include the 777 slot and most live dealer and table classics like baccarat, roulette, craps, and sic bo.

Fortnightly Cashback and daily recovery options
If you prefer predictable cycles, the Fortnightly Cashback can be appealing. Every two weeks Pacific Spins tallies losses and can credit up to 10% back depending on VIP status (Admiral of the Fleet reaching the top tier). Fortnightly cashback carries a 30x wagering requirement, a minimum allowed cashback of $5, and a maximum cashout set at whichever is greater: 5x the cashback amount or $50.
On top of these, Pacific Spins runs Daily Rewards based on the previous day’s losses — from free spins for smaller losses to free chips for larger ones — providing multiple ways to offset downswings.
